Introduction:

Mechanical engineering is the most important industry. Its products are machines of various types that are supplied to all branches of the national economy. The growth of industry and the national economy, as well as the pace of re-equipment of their new equipment, largely depend on the level of development of mechanical engineering .

Technological progress in mechanical engineering is characterized not only by an improvement in the design of machines, but also by a continuous improvement in the technology of their production. Currently, it is important to manufacture a machine in a high-quality, cheap and time-consuming manner, using modern high-performance equipment, tools, technological equipment, mechanization and automation of production. The durability and reliability of the produced machines, as well as the economy of their operation, largely depend on the adopted production technology. The improvement of mechanical engineering technology is determined by the needs of production of machines necessary for society.

Theoretical developments and practice have shown that in the conditions of single, small-scale and mass production, characteristic of 80% of machine-building and instrument-making enterprises, the most rational is the organization of group production based on the unification of its objects, technological processes and equipment, as well as on the creation of specific-specialized sections and multi-nomenclature group flow and automated lines. Group production makes it possible to carry out the most complete work on mechanization and automation of equipment and labor. Its application is especially effective in conditions of concentration of production and creation of associations.

Today's requirements for mechanical engineering are the creation of high-performance machines and equipment, the reduction of their material and energy consumption, the introduction of low-waste and waste-free technological processes, and the reduction of labor intensity of production due to the wide introduction of various automation and mechanization tools.

The problem of improving and technological assurance of accuracy in mechanical engineering is very urgent. Precision in mechanical engineering is of great importance for improving the performance of machines and for the technology of their production.

Gearbox assembly

Prior to assembly, inner cavity of reducer housing is thoroughly cleaned and covered with oil-resistant paint.

Assembly is performed in accordance with gearbox assembly drawing, starting from shaft assemblies:

Bearings pre-heated in oil to 80100 ° C are fitted on the drive shaft-gear;

A key is put into the driven shaft and the gear wheel is pressed to rest against the shaft collar and ball bearings pre-heated in oil are installed.

The assembled shafts are laid in the base of the reduction gear case and put on the cover of the case, covering previously the surfaces of the joint of the cover and the case with sealant. For alignment, a cover is installed on the body using two conical pins; bolts that attach the cover to the housing are tightened.

Prior to installation of through covers felt seals impregnated with hot oil are put into grooves. By turning the shafts there is no jamming of bearings (the shafts must be rotated by hand) and the covers are fixed with screws.

Then plug of oil discharge hole with gasket and iron oil indicator are screwed in.

Oil is poured into housing and inspection hole is closed with cover with gasket made of technical cardboard; cover is bolted.

The assembled gearbox is rolled and tested on the bench according to the program set by the specifications.
